Biographical Info:

Dr. Olufunso O. Abosede is the Acting Head of Department of Chemistry at Federal University Otuoke. He was previously the Head of Department of Science Education and Coordinator of Student Industrial Work Experience Scheme (SIWES) at the same institution. He holds BSc., MSc., and Ph.D. in Chemistry from the University of Ilorin, Nigeria.
His research expertise lies in Inorganic and Materials Chemistry, with a focus on Coordination Chemistry, Bio-inorganic Chemistry, Green Chemistry, Nanoscience, Crystallography, and Crystallography Education. Dr. Abosede's current research focuses on the synthesis and characterization of new compounds with therapeutic applications.
He has received multiple grants to support his research and scientific engagement, including the TetFund Institution-Based Grant (October 2024), Frank H. Allen International Research and Education (FAIRE) Programme Grant from Cambridge Crystallography Data Centre (CCDC) in October 2024, Engagement Grant Award from CCDC (November 2024), and the 2025 Global Innovation Imperatives (Gii) Grant from the American Chemical Society. Other awards and fellowships won by Dr. Abosede include TWAS-DBT postgraduate fellowship in 2012, Individual Research Grant from International Foundation for Science (Sweden) in 2015, and individual Green Chemistry research grant from UNESCO/IUPAC/PhosAgro partnership in 2018.
He has worked in multicultural societies, including during his TWAS-DBT postgraduate fellowship at Savitribai Phule Pune University, India, and during a postdoctoral fellowship at Nelson Mandela University, South Africa. Dr. Abosede is a member of several international scientific organizations and serves as a reviewer for multiple internationally peer-reviewed high-impact chemistry journals.
Notably, Dr. Abosede holds key leadership positions in professional organizations, including:
- Secretary, Nigerian Crystallography Association
- Councillor representing Nigeria, African Crystallography Society
- Public Relations Officer, International Foundation for Science, Nigeria Alumni Association
- Faculty Advisor, American Chemical Society International Student Chapter at Federal University Otuoke
Through his research and scientific engagements, Dr. Abosede continues to advance knowledge in chemistry, enhance scientific capacity building, and promote sustainability and the application of crystallography and structural science in Nigeria and beyond.
